Phra Khattiya Wongsa (Thon) Monument

This statue Monument is located at the center of the Sai Nam Phueng Roundabout, which is near the RoiEt College of Dramatic Arts. The depicted Phra Khattiyawongsa (Thon) was the son of Thao Chan Kaeo, a high-ranking royal appointee. He was chosen to be the first ruler of RoiEt in 1775 during the reign of King Taksin the Great. The historic leader also founded the city by bringing in settlers from Mueang Thong to Mueang Roi Et (also called Mueang Kum Raeng). He is considered a great ruler as he was able turn Roi Et into one of the most prosperous cities in the Northeastern region.
